Read moreAmy Patel, MD, Chair of the American College of Radiology Association® Radiology Advocacy Network and RADPAC® is in the running for NFL Fan of the Year, and time is running out to vote for her.
At the start of the NFL season, Dr. Patel was chosen by the Kansas City Chiefs as their Fan of the Year, which automatically put her in the running for NFL Fan of the Year. Dr. Patel has been using her platform as an NFL Fan of the Year nominee to raise breast cancer awareness and the importance of early detection.
